    All the way from Scotland, Stewart Buchanan is the Global Brand Ambassador for Glenglassaugh, BenRiach, and Glendronach. Stewart is one of the few global brand ambassador’s Pat knows that worked in a distillery. Stewart brought three bottles of the latest offerings from Glenglassaugh. The distillery had previously been mothballed from 1986 to 2008 but since its reopening it has been subsequently sold to Brown-Forman. Since then, they’ve reopened and begun distilling again, as well as reviving their floor malting program.   • The Last Word on Chartreuse and Chartreuse Alternatives

    08/09/2023 Duração: 58min

    Chartreuse has been around for centuries and always popular with mixologists. It took a global pandemic to make the French herbal liqueur a household name though. Carthusian monks have been making it by hand since the 1700s and were always able to keep up with demand. In the last few years, they have decreased production to focus more on being monks instead of liquor executives. Now you can pretty much only get it in the US if you own a bar. Roger has poured samples of Chartreuse and six alternatives. Additionally, he made seven Last Word cocktails with each of the seven samples. We’re blind tasting these seven samples, hoping to find an alternative to Chartreuse that is just as good and readily available in our stores. After we try all of that, Roger will whip up two more Chartreuse cocktails.   • Old Potrero Master Distiller Bruce Joseph

    30/06/2023 Duração: 45min

    It’s another Whiskey Hotline episode! Bruce Joseph is the master distiller at Hotaling & Company, formerly Anchor Brewing & Distilling. Hotaling is best known for their Old Potrero ryes. Bruce started working at Anchor Brewing straight out of college in 1980. He was a brewer for 13 years until they got licensed to distill and he switched over. Fritz Maytag was interested in making rye whiskey, particularly its historical ties to Colonial America.
